PhD position in Time-Resolved Crystallography of Enzymes (STRIDE project)
We invite applicants for an externally‑funded three‑year PhD fellowship within structural enzymology and time‑resolved crystallography. The STRIDE project (Synchrotron‑based Time‑Resolved crystallographic Investigations of Dynamic states in Esterase catalysis via novel analogues) is funded by the Novo Nordisk Foundation as a MicroMAX Collaborative Research Grant, in collaboration with the University of Gothenburg and Chalmers University of Technology.
Start date: 1 January 2027 (or as soon as possible thereafter)
The PhD candidate will be based at the University of Copenhagen (UCPH) and supervised by Prof. Leila Lo Leggio. The project has two closely connected strands:
- 1) Synthesis and evaluation of novel substrate analogues for esterases, including slowly cleavable and photoswitchable compounds.
